Hemis is a 4400 sq km national park that has earned the title of the largest in India. This Ladakh national park is so popular among places to visit in Leh Ladakh for wildlife tourists and is well-known for its large number of snow leopards. The park is said to have the largest population of snow leopards of any protected region worldwide. There are 73 species of birds and 15 species of animals in the park. Other endangered species found in the park include the Tibetan wolf, the Eurasian brown bear, and a variety of bird species. It is an escape for nature enthusiasts and explorers because of its amazing scenery, which include tall mountains and deep valleys. Here, conservation initiatives are essential to safeguarding these threatened species and maintaining the delicate Himalayan environment.

Situated in Ladakh, India, Changthang Cold Desert Wildlife Sanctuary is widely recognized for being a singular high-altitude sanctuary. It is also known for its chilly desert scenery, which include enormous areas of barren environment, snow-capped mountains, and high-altitude lakes like Tso Moriri and Tso Kar. Rare and endangered animals including the Tibetan wild ass (kiang), snow leopard, Tibetan wolf, and several bird species like the black-necked crane can be found in the sanctuary. For photographers and wildlife fans hoping to capture the wild beauty of the Himalayas and see these strong species thriving in harsh environments, it's the ultimate destination for photographers.

In the Ladakh area, the magnificent landscapes and great biodiversity of the Karakoram (Nubra Shyok) Wildlife Sanctuary are popular with tourists. Situated within the mountainous Karakoram Range, it is widely known for its unique blend of desert and mountainous environments. Numerous species of animals could be found in the sanctuary, such as the Himalayan brown bear, Asiatic ibex, Tibetan wolf, and the elusive snow leopard. For those who enjoy the outdoors and adventure, it's gorgeous valleys, natural mountains, and flowing rivers—like the Shyok River—make it a wonderful place. The preservation of this pure area and the protection of the endangered animals that live here depend heavily on conservation efforts.

The Tso Kar Basin Wildlife Sanctuary in Ladakh, India, is popular for its diversified birds and stunning high-altitude views. The picturesque Tso Kar Lake and the wetlands around it are known for drawing migrating species, including bar-headed geese and black-necked cranes, among many others. Great crested grebes and Tibetan snowcocks are among the local bird species that the sanctuary supports. These birds depend on this area for their breeding and feeding activities due to its diverse environment of grasslands and salt marshlands. Bird watchers and nature lovers visit this sanctuary to take in the beauty of these species of birds against the backdrop of the Himalayas.
